I have a fresh copy. Reasonably successful with it but I would like a mode that would give me more options (like Shrink). I have run into trouble with backing up my Men In Black original. The movie works great on the PC but will not play on the TV. I tried reripping, recoding and reburning it several times with no success. I have read that the problem could be in the IFO files so I downloaded IFOedit to have a look but that code is a little over my head at the moment. If Shrink will crunch the "movie only" and give me an IFO file that plays the one movie file on the disk I will be a happy camper. So that is my next step.
